Kennywood has an unmatched mix of more than 40 modern attractions and one-of-a-kind classic rides, including eight roller coasters, a Kiddieland with pint-sized thrills for the little ones, and more. Kennywood's rich history spans generations of good times and extends beyond the traditional summer season with popular Halloween and Holiday events.
